Highland Recorder August 20, 1909
James M. Botkin's Administrator and others vs. James M. Botkin's widow and others, I will, on TUESDAY, AUGUST 31st, 1900 - offer for sale at public auction, on the premises, that certain tract of land of which James M. Botkin lately died seized, containing, by recent survey, 469 acres, lying on Shaw's Ridge, in Highland County, Virginia, adjoining the lands of John A. Botkin and others. The whole of the tract will be offered subject to the assignment of the dower made to James M. Botkin's widow of 45.25 acres of said land, possession of the purchaser will be entitled to at her death; and then the part of the remaining after the assignment of dower being 422.75 acres will be offered, and the sale will be made so that the best price can be realized.
